Features of choroidal thickness and choroidal vascularity in the macular region of adult patients with myopia based on swept-source optical coherence tomography
Objective To investigate the features and changing trend of choroidal thickness and choroidal vascularity in the macular region of adult patients with myopia by using swept-source optical coherence tomography(SS-OCTA). Methods A cross-sectional study was conducted among 138 adult patients with myopia(138 right eyes),aged 18-36 years,who attended the outpatient service of Department of Ophthalmology,The First Affiliated Hospital of Chongqing Medical University,from April 2023 to October 2023,and routine ophthalmic examination was performed for all patients,including refractive status and axial length(AL). According to spherical equivalent (SE),the patients were divided into low myopia group(-3D<SE≤-0.5D),moderate myopia group(-6D<SE≤-3D),and high myopia group (SE≤-6D). SS-OCTA was used to observe and quantify mean choroidal thickness(MCT),choriocapillaris blood flow area(CBFA),choroidal vessel volume(CVV),and choroidal vessel index(CVI) of the 3 mm×3 mm macular region. MCT and choroidal vascularity parameters were compared between the groups with different degrees of myopia,and their changing trends were analyzed. Results There were significant differences between the groups with different degrees of myopia in MCT,CBFA,CVV,and CVI in the central fovea,the parafovea,and the whole macular region within the 3 mm×3 mm area,which decreased with the increase in the degree of myopia(P<0.01). After elimination of confounding factors,the partial correlation analysis showed that MCT,CBFA,CVV,and CVI in the whole macular region were positively correlated with SE(r=0.457,0.434,0.395,and 0.401,all P=0.000) and were negatively correlated with AL(r=-0.470,-0.360,-0.465,and -0.468,all P=0.000). The stepwise linear regression analysis showed that MCT gradually increased with the increase in SE(t=2.459,P=0.015) and CVV(t=8.632,P=0.000). Conclusion MCT in the macular region shows heterogeneous distribution in adult patients with myopia,and MCT and choroidal vascularity parameters in the macular region decrease with the increase in the degree of myopia,while choroidal vascularity closely affects choroidal thickness. The choroid may be an important biomarker for myopia,and the research findings of this study can help to reveal the association between myopia and the choroid.
